Coinciding with its five-year anniversary, Blue-tec this week announced a new version Ulysses 1.6, its Mac OS X-based text editor. Aimed at the creative writing market, version 1.6 includes an innovative 'tabbed' single-window user interface, comprehensive filtering and search system, semantic text editing, and a 'preview as you type' window. The update also offers bug fixes, further improved UI, extended printing capabilities, enhanced search/replace features, and new Hungarian and Portuguese localizations. The software requires Mac OS X 10.4 or later and is priced at €80 for a single-user license. A 30-day free trial is available from blue-tec.com.

In addition, the company has updated Ulysses Core, a lighter version of text editor. Aimed at 'the creative writer who doesn't need the full feature set of its more expensive sibling, it offers a similar UI and many of the advanced features such as 'semantic text editing." Ulysses Core is priced at €40; it also requires OS X 10.4.
